AdmissionRequirements

Competitive but transparent โ€” requirements vary by program, here's the general baseline

Academic Background

4-year bachelor's degree (or 3-year + 1-year masters) from recognized university, min 3.0/4.0 GPA

Standardized Tests

GRE required for most STEM programs; GMAT for MBA; waivers possible for strong profiles

English Proficiency

TOEFL iBT 79+, IELTS 6.5+, Duolingo 110+ (higher for some programs)

Application Package

SOP, 3 LORs, CV, transcripts, test scores, $95 fee โ€” all submitted online

Frequently AskedQuestions

1

Is University of Minnesota Twin Cities accredited?

Yes, the University of Minnesota is accredited by the Higher Learning Commission (HLC) and holds numerous program-specific accreditations including ABET, AACSB, CCNE, and more.

2

What is the acceptance rate for international graduate students?

Graduate acceptance rates vary by program but typically range from 15-35% for competitive programs. The university evaluates applications holistically.

3

Is GRE required for admission?

GRE requirements vary by program. Many STEM programs require GRE, while some professional programs may waive it based on work experience or GPA. Check your specific program requirements.

4

What are the English language requirements?

Minimum TOEFL iBT 79, IELTS 6.5, or Duolingo 110. Some programs may have higher requirements. Students from English-medium institutions may qualify for waivers.

5

Can international students work while studying?

Yes, F-1 visa holders can work up to 20 hours/week on-campus during semesters and full-time during breaks. CPT and OPT are available for off-campus work related to your field of study.
